1# This is an approximation of what we want for a real linux system (with MMU and ELF).
2MACHINE=
3SCRIPT_NAME=elf
4OUTPUT_FORMAT="elf32-cris"
5NO_REL_RELOCS=yes
6ARCH=cris
7TEMPLATE_NAME=elf32
8
9ENTRY=_start
10
11# Needed?  Perhaps should be page-size alignment.
12ALIGNMENT=32
13GENERATE_SHLIB_SCRIPT=yes
14
15# Is this high enough and low enough?
16TEXT_START_ADDR=0x80000
17
18MAXPAGESIZE="CONSTANT (MAXPAGESIZE)"
19
20# We don't do the hoops through DEFINED to provide [_]*start, as it
21# doesn't work with --gc-sections, and the start-name is pretty fixed
22# anyway.
23TEXT_START_SYMBOLS='PROVIDE (__Stext = .);'
24
25# Smuggle an "OTHER_TEXT_END_SYMBOLS" here.
26OTHER_READONLY_SECTIONS="${RELOCATING+PROVIDE (__Etext = .);}"
27DATA_START_SYMBOLS='PROVIDE (__Sdata = .);'
28
29# Smuggle an "OTHER_DATA_END_SYMBOLS" here.
30OTHER_SDATA_SECTIONS="${RELOCATING+PROVIDE (__Edata = .);}"
31OTHER_BSS_SYMBOLS='PROVIDE (__Sbss = .);'
32OTHER_BSS_END_SYMBOLS='PROVIDE (__Ebss = .);'
33
34# Also add the other symbols provided for rsim/xsim and elinux.
35OTHER_SYMBOLS='
36  PROVIDE (__Eall = .);
37  PROVIDE (__Endmem = 0x10000000); 
38  PROVIDE (__Stacksize = 0);
39'
40NO_SMALL_DATA=yes
